Dear Diary,
Today it’s Friday. Friday is one of my favourite days of the week as I have some of my favourite lessons.
Firstly, I have English. I like English because we sometimes do games and it is really fun. Also, I like doing group work.
Next, I have French! In today’s lesson we followed instructions and coloured in and cut out a stable with Jesus in it. I found this enjoyable.
After break, I have two lessons of Technology one after the other – right up to lunch. In Technology,we make all sorts of things. So far, we have made doorbells, torches and key rings. After lunch I have P. E .This is my favourite lesson because I re ally like sport .We are able to do all kinds of different sports ; tennis, football, cricket, rugby and many more!
After Celebration Assembly in the afternoon, it’s time to go home.

Dear Diary
It was my favourite day today – Thursday. As usual, I walked to school. However, it was snowing today. It was really hard not to slip over and, if I did, I’d look round to make sure nobody saw how silly I looked.
My first and second lessons – Technology – were good fun. We were planning and designing a bag which had to be made out of recycled clothes and fabrics. My friends and I had a great time.
After morning break, I had Humanities. It was a bit different today. We each received a letter from a child, around our age, from Ghana in Africa. It was really interesting to find out what their everyday lifestyle is like and what their village is like too.
Next, I had Art. Art is my favourite subject and I’m also on the Gifted and Talented Register for this subject. I really enjoy drawing. At the moment we are drawing our own versions of famous artists’ drawing and paintings. It’s amazing to see all of the different types of art from around the world.
At lunchtime, I ate my food and then had a good time with some of my friends. After French in the afternoon, I walked home with my friends, laughing about what a good day we have had and how we can’t wait until tomorrow.

Dear Diary
It’s Friday – my favourite day of the week. It’s the weekend the next day and the day when I enjoy my lessons the most.
My first lesson was English. I like this subject as, when you’re writing, there is no right or wrong answer and it can be personal and individual.
French next. If language was only words and no sentences, I would be a master! But in French, like any language, we use sentences to communicate and I need to work on constructing sentences using the words I have learnt.
After a twenty minute break I had R.E.The lessons are fun and I learn a lot as we l l .This Friday we only had half the lesson as we were due to visit Harlington Upper School to watch their production of We Will Rock You! The musical featured music by Queen.Year 8 re a l ly enjoyed the show.
When we arrived back in school,we had the last half hour of Art where we we re taking somebody else’s picture and redrawing it on a larger scale. I like Art, as I enjoy being able to express things without the need for words.
